Jack Grealish could be heading for Everton in one of the most surprising deals of the 2026 summer transfer deadline day.
The Manchester City winger is reportedly set to join Everton on loan as the Toffees attempt to strengthen their attacking options before the window closes. The move would give Grealish an opportunity to play more regularly while allowing Everton to add an experienced Premier League creator to their squad.
Grealish’s situation at Manchester City has been closely watched since his big-money move to the club. Despite producing moments of quality, consistent first-team football has been difficult to guarantee, particularly with City’s depth in attacking areas.
A loan to Everton could therefore represent an important career reset.
For Everton, the potential arrival is equally significant. Grealish could provide creativity, ball retention and the ability to unlock defensive teams, qualities that could make a major difference during a demanding Premier League campaign.
However, questions remain about whether Everton can get the best version of the England international.
If Grealish becomes a regular starter and rediscovers his confidence, the loan could quickly become one of the smartest deals of the summer.
But if he struggles to adapt, Everton may regret relying on a player whose recent career has been surrounded by uncertainty.
Either way, Grealish’s possible move has added another fascinating twist to an already dramatic deadline day.
